A Brief History of Robot Vacuums
The principle of automated cleaning devices goes back to the early 20th century, but it wasn't until the late 1990s that the first commercially effective robot vacuum was introduced. The iRobot Roomba, launched in 2002, was a game-changer. At first, these devices were basic, relying on random navigation and minimal sensors. However, for many years, advancements in robotics, expert system, and device learning have actually led to more sophisticated designs that can navigate complex environments, avoid barriers, and tidy better.
How Robot Vacuums Work

Navigation Systems:
- ** RANDOM NAVIGATION: ** Early models used random navigation, relocating no specific pattern to cover the floor.
- ** MAPPING TECHNOLOGY: ** Modern best robot hoover vacuums use sophisticated mapping innovation, such as LIDAR (Light Detection and Ranging) and VSLAM (Visual Simultaneous Localization and Mapping), to create a map of the space and navigate effectively.
- ** SENSORS: ** Various sensing units, including infrared, ultrasonic, and cliff sensing units, assist the robot discover obstacles and avoid falls.
** Cleaning Mechanisms: **
- ** BRUSHES: ** Most robot vacuums have a mix of brushes, including side brushes and primary brushes, to sweep and gather dirt.
- ** SUCTION: ** The suction power varies among designs, with higher-end units using more effective suction to manage a variety of cleaning needs.
- ** FILTERS: ** HEPA filters are typically used to trap allergens and fine particles, making robot vacuums advantageous for individuals with allergies.
** Connectivity and Control: **
- ** SMART HOME INTEGRATION: ** Many robot vacuums can be integrated with smart home systems, allowing users to control them through voice commands or smart device apps.
- ** SCHEDULED CLEANING: ** Users can set schedules for the robot to clean at particular times, making sure a clean home without manual intervention.

Often Asked Questions (FAQs)
1. Are robot vacuum that mops vacuums worth the investment?
- Answer: Yes, for lots of people, robot vacuums are worth the investment. They provide benefit, conserve time, and can improve the general cleanliness of a home. Nevertheless, the worth may differ depending on specific needs and budget plan.
2. How do I set up a robot vacuum?
- Answer: Setting up a robot vacuum is generally uncomplicated. Place the robot in the charging dock, connect it to Wi-Fi (if relevant), and use the app or control panel to set cleaning schedules and choices. Some models might require the installation of virtual walls or limit markers to delineate cleaning areas.
3. Can robot vacuums clean stairs?
- Answer: Most robot vacuums are not designed to clean stairs. They use cliff sensing units to find the edge of stairs and prevent falling. Nevertheless, some specialized models are readily available for stair cleaning.
4. How often should I clear the dust bin?
- Answer: It is advised to clear the dust bin after each cleaning session to ensure the robot runs at optimal effectiveness. This likewise helps prevent odors and the spread of dust.
5. Are robot vacuums suitable for pet owners?
- Response: Yes, lots of robot vacuums are specifically developed for pet owners. They have powerful suction and specialized attachments to get rid of pet hair and dander efficiently.
6. Can robot vacuums clean under furnishings?
- Answer: Yes, the majority of robot vacuums are created to fit under furnishings and clean these locations. Their slim profiles and advanced navigation systems make it possible to reach tight areas.
7. What is the life-span of a robot vacuum?
- Response: The life expectancy of a robot vacuum can differ, however most designs last between 2 to 5 years with proper maintenance. Regular cleaning and battery care can extend their life-span.
